WebOct 13, 2010 · 1. I just use the following: Find the normalized vectors AB, and AC, where A is the common point of the segments. V = (AB + AC) * 0.5 // produces the direction vector that bisects AB and AC. Normalize V, then do A + V * length to get the line segment of the desired length that starts at the common point. WebThis program implements Bisection Method for finding real root of nonlinear function in C++ programming language. In this C++ program, x0 & x1 are two initial guesses, e is tolerable error, f (x) is actual function whose root is being obtained using bisection method and x is variable which holds and bisected value at each iteration.
